发明名称 INDEXING AND LOCKING MECHANISM FOR A TURNTABLE
摘要 1. Indexing and locking mechanism for a rotary turn table (1) on a table carrier body (2) comprising : - an indexing and locking ring (9) fastened to the rotary table, coaxial to the latter, and provided with notches (26) of a generally V-shaped section cut in a main marginal surface of revolution (31) adjacent to an auxiliary marginal surface of revolution (32) into which the said notches lead laterally, the flanks of these notches (26) being divergent, from the bottom of the notches, both towards the main marginal surface of revolution (31) and towards the auxiliary marginal surface of revolution (32), - a plurality of indexing and locking balls (25) partially engaged permanently respectively in (axial or radial) rectilinear grooves (23), likewise of generally V-shaped section, formed in a surface of revolution of the table carrier body (2) coaxial to the indexing and locking ring (9) and situated opposite the auxiliary marginal surface of revolution (32) of the indexing and locking ring, the flanks of the said grooves (23) in the table carrier body (2) being divergent from the bottom to the outside, the balls (25) being adapted to occupy selectively along the said grooves either a position locking the table, in which they are also partially engaged in the notches (26) in the indexing and locking ring (9) (figure 3) or a position in which the table (1) is freed and in which they are situated outside the said notches (26) (figure 4), - and locking control means (6) for urging the indexing and locking balls (25) along the grooves (23) in the table carrier body (2), characterized in that the locking control means are composed of a cam (6) mounted for pivoting coaxially to the indexing and locking ring (9) and also having, on the one hand, a main marginal surface of revolution (35) facing the notched main marginal surface of revolution (31) of the indexing and locking ring (9) and provided with a number of notches (27) equal to the number of grooves (23) in the table carrier body (2), and, on the other hand, an auxiliary marginal surface of revolution (36) adjacent to the main marginal surface of revolution and into which the notches (27) in the cam lead laterally, the auxiliary marginal surface of revolution (36) of the cam being situated in the extension of the auxiliary marginal surface of revolution (32) of the indexing and locking ring and also opposite that surface of revolution of the table carrier body (2) in which the rectilinear grooves (23) are formed, the notches (27) in the cam having a likewise generally V-shaped section with flanks which diverge, from the bottom of the notches, both towards the main marginal surface of revolution (35) and towards the auxiliary marginal surface of revolution (36) of the said cam, in such a manner that in an angular position of the cam (6) corresponding to the locking of the rotary table (1), the parts of the main marginal surface of revolution (35) of the cam which are situated between the notches (27) on that surface hold the balls pressed against the flanks of the notches (26) in the indexing and locking ring (9) against the flanks of the grooves (23) in the table carrier body (2) while in an angular position of the cam (6) corresponding to the unlocking of the rotary table (1) the balls (25) can pass completely out of the notches (26) in the indexing and locking ring (9) and penetrate into the notches (27) in the cam, thus freeing the ring for rotation.
